Transaction 326944a915833db645b0ea7d33aa5a6db5cd8113342e2070b5d7b4c0c835bd29
1 Input
1 Output
-
326944a915833db645b0ea7d33aa5a6db5cd8113342e2070b5d7b4c0c835bd29:0
- value
- 63104
- script pubkey
- OP_0 OP_PUSHBYTES_20 7085d8169c2344e68404c4e131fe0f82c83e9365
- address
- bc1qwzzas95uydzwdpqycnsnrls0styraym983tkw4